How much do seasonal ecommerce writer j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 2, 2026, the average hourly pay for seasonal ecommerce writer in the United States is $24.29,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$18.51 and $27.88 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between Seasonal Ecommerce Writer vs Product Description Writer?

AspectSeasonal Ecommerce WriterProduct Description Writer
CredentialsTypically requires strong writing skills, familiarity with ecommerce platforms, and seasonal marketing knowledgeRequires excellent product knowledge, persuasive writing skills, and SEO understanding
Work EnvironmentOften freelance or in-house, focused on seasonal campaigns and product launchesUsually in-house or freelance, focused on detailed product listings and descriptions
Industry UsageCommon in retail, fashion, and holiday marketing sectorsUsed across ecommerce, retail, and consumer goods industries

The main difference is that a Seasonal Ecommerce Writer focuses on creating content for seasonal campaigns and promotions, while a Product Description Writer specializes in crafting detailed, persuasive descriptions for individual products. Both roles require strong writing skills and industry knowledge, but their focus and scope differ based on campaign timing versus product-specific content.

JOB DESCRIPTION
The Fox News Deals team is seeking a shopping-obsessed writer with expertise in tech and home products. In this role, your daily tasks will include researching, pitching and writing multiple articles (round-ups, gift guides, product reviews, etc) for publication across FOX properties, including Fox News and FOX Weather.
Along with daily assignments, this person will join the core writing team covering tentpole shopping events like Prime Day, Black Friday and Cyber Monday. This person should be a multitasker who can work effectively, efficiently and quickly while managing multiple assignments. The candidate should have excellent writing skills, experience in implementing SEO tactics and have a background in journalism or another related field.
A SNAPSHOT OF YOUR RESPONSIBILITIES
  • Write daily articles and evergreen stories (6-10 a week)
  • Research new products and trends, as well as competitor content picks, to make sure we always make the best recommendations to our readers
  • Keep on top of new product launches to ensure our content always has the most up to date products. This may involve helping test and review new products
  • Research and pitch new content based on audience insights, historical performance, seasonal search trends and other revenue-generation measures.
  • Work closely with our partnerships and growth teams to ensure content is optimized for maximum revenue generation
  • Follow in-house style and brand safety guidelines
  • Cover tentpole shopping events like Prime Day, Black Friday and Cyber Monday
  • Participate in team meetings to help strategize editorial coverage, optimize user experience and revenue generation, including for tentpole shopping events.
  • Explore and pursue ways to grow commerce partnerships via content coverage.

WHAT YOU WILL NEED
  • 3+ years of writing experience including writing samples illustrating commerce coverage across verticals.
  • Daily experience working within a CMS (familiarity with WordPress preferred)
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ills, including knowledge of AP style
  • Excellent time management and prioritization skills, meticulous and consistent follow up
  • Proven track record of executing revenue-driving articles (both deals-centric and evergreen)
  • Attention to detail, an aptitude for working under tight deadlines and effectively handling multiple priorities simultaneously
